Ibis Budget Leuven Centrum
3.6/557 Reviews
I spent 4 nights here, only a place to sleep really. The staff were very helpful and friendly. Breakfast included, which was a decent continental buffet. Location was great for me, next to the railway station. A subway next to the hotel led to platforms and the main station on the other side of the tracks. Reception is actually on the road above the subway, but there is a paved path , designed for cyclists I guess, which avoids using the steps. Bring your own kettle as none in room. Bed was comfortable and I knew about the lack of wardrobe or drawers. I was on the top floor and had no noise from outside.

Hotel the Shepherd
4.1/528 Reviews
Spent a long weekend at Hotel The Shepherd. Nice clean hotel. Everything looked neat and good. Nice room, only sliding glass door to the bathroom and toilet gives little privacy. Bathroom is small and only has a shower. Rooms were cleaned well and provided with new beds. Good beds. Perfect location to the old market and food and drink options, ideal hotel to spend a few days in Leuven. Wifi is good and free. Breakfast was simply well prepared and more than sufficient. Quiet hotel, little noise in the hotel itself. The school opposite caused quite a bit of noise until late in the evening and early in the morning by means of loud music. Parking opposite the hotel was not possible, so you had to park at the Q-park parking garage, which will cost you 22 euros per day. Easily accessible, both by car and on foot. Parking at the hotel apparently only costs 15 euros. You must call in time to discuss this otherwise there will be no room!! All sights within a short distance. Must say that 1 or 2 days in Leuven was sufficient for us.
